Have you ever wondered what it really means to lead in a world where artificial intelligence has become a strategic partner? In the current context, where technology is advancing by leaps and bounds, our understanding of leadership is undergoing a metamorphosis. Rather than being a figure who makes decisions alone, the leader of the future must learn to collaborate with AI, merging human intuition with the data processing power of machines. This new model of human-AI co-leadership promises to transform the way we interact and make critical decisions in our organizations.
The topic of co-leadership could not come at a better time. In an increasingly dynamic and globalized work environment, leaders face the challenge of adapting to new expectations and realities. They are expected not only to manage people but also to effectively integrate technology into their strategies. This is where collaboration with AI becomes essential; it's not just about tools that help automate processes, but about a partner that can provide valuable insights for decision-making.
The article by Vilma Nuñez invites us to reflect on this crucial change in our perception of leadership: “AI responds better when it understands not just what is being requested, but also the why behind it.” This statement underscores the importance of establishing a deep connection between leaders and AI, where both work together to achieve common goals. The key lies in creating an environment that values co-creation and prioritizes effective communication.
The ability to co-create with AI not only allows for faster decision-making but can also greatly enrich the process by combining human creativity with algorithmic logic. This will not only promote innovation but also strengthen the organizational culture, giving every team member the opportunity to contribute their unique perspective. As we cultivate an atmosphere of collaboration and inclusiveness, we elevate the creativity and engagement of the team, resulting in tangible outcomes and improved collective morale.
However, this integration of AI into leadership also has broad and profound implications. For example, the younger audience entering the labor market is demanding leaders who understand and utilize advanced technologies. This means that, as leaders, we must stay abreast of technological trends and adapt to the expectations of our teams. As John C. Maxwell points out, “Leaders must be close enough to relate to others, but far enough ahead to motivate them.” Being a tech-savvy leader enables us to connect more effectively with new generations.
Additionally, the implementation of AI presents significant ethical challenges. Algorithmic decisions can be influenced by biases and lack of transparency, requiring us to take on a dual responsibility: not only must we integrate technology but do so ethically and responsibly. As Winston Churchill said, “The price of greatness is responsibility.” Leaders must be aware of how their decisions, when incorporating new technologies, can impact both individuals and society as a whole.
Finally, the journey towards co-leadership poses the need for a new organizational structure. The democratization of the decision-making process, facilitated by AI, may lead to a more horizontal model that empowers employees at all levels. This change will represent a step towards a more agile and adaptable organizational culture. As Steve Jobs observed, “Innovation distinguishes between a leader and a follower.” Organizations that adopt these principles will be better positioned to thrive and maintain a competitive advantage.
For those looking to advance in this new landscape, here are three practical steps they can implement:
- Foster a culture of collaboration: Create spaces where teams can share ideas and work together with technology. Brainstorming and co-creation sessions should actively involve all team members.
- Promote continuous technology training: Encourage your team to stay updated on the advanced tools they can use. Provide training and resources to ensure everyone feels comfortable and empowered to use AI in their roles.
- Establish clear ethical principles: Develop an ethical framework to guide the use of AI in decision-making. Ensure everyone understands the importance of making transparent and unbiased decisions.
